When considering shipping containers for sale, it's vital to understand the various types readily available. Below is a table summing up the numerous container types and their specifications:
Container TypeDimensions (L x W x H)Capacity (CBM)Common UsesRequirement 20ft20' x 8' x 8.5'33.2Storage, workshopsStandard 40ft40' x 8' x 8.5'67.7Storage, retail areasHigh Cube 20ft20' x 8' x 9.5'37.0Storage of tall productsHigh Cube 40ft40' x 8' x 9.5'76.4Modular homes, officesReefer Container20'/ 40' (varied)VariedTemperature-sensitive itemsTips for Buying Shipping Containers
When considering purchasing a shipping container, keep the list below factors in mind:
Purpose: Identify the primary use of the container to determine the size and specs required.Condition: Shipping containers typically come in two conditions: New Shipping Containers (one-trip) and used. New containers are more costly but use much better durability, while used containers are budget-friendly however might have visible wear.Inspection: Always examine the container for structural integrity, rust, and damage. An extensive evaluation can save future headaches.Delivery Options: Consider delivery logistics. Some sellers provide delivery services, while others may require you to get the container yourself.Local Regulations: Check regional zoning laws and building regulations, particularly if you plan to utilize the container as a long-term structure.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Where can I buy shipping containers?
Shipping containers can be bought from numerous sources, consisting of manufacturers, shipping lines, and specialized container merchants. Online marketplaces such as Craigslist, eBay, or dedicated container websites are also excellent options.
2. Just how much do shipping containers cost?
The cost of a shipping container can vary considerably based upon its condition, size, and location. Normally, prices can range from ₤ 2,000 to ₤ 5,000 for used containers, while new containers may cost between ₤ 5,000 to ₤ 7,000.
3. Do I require an authorization to put a Refrigerated Shipping Containers container on my home?
It depends on regional zoning laws and guidelines. Some areas might need permits for positioning shipping containers, specifically if they will be used as long-term structures. Constantly check with local authorities before making a purchase.
4. Can I modify a shipping container?
Yes, shipping containers are highly adjustable. Many business concentrate on modifying containers for homes, workplaces, and other functions. Modifications may include adding doors, windows, insulation, and electrical systems.
5. For how long do shipping containers last?
With appropriate maintenance, shipping containers can last 25 years or more. Elements impacting their life-span include ecological conditions, use, and upkeep practices.
